Digging in to School Issues with Analytical Models
The blog post discusses various analytical models for addressing challenges in schools. It covers the Why-Why Analysis for identifying root causes, the 5 Ws and 2 Hs for comprehensive situation assessment, Fishbone Diagrams for visualizing problem causes, and Mindmaps for brainstorming and strategic planning. These models are presented as tools to help school leaders understand and solve complex issues through structured analysis and creative thinking.

Cultivating Commitment: The Spectrum of Staff Roles in Stakeholder Engagement
The article emphasises the critical importance of commitment, engagement, and alignment in organisational development within schools. It outlines that successful change initiatives require unwavering commitment from school leadership, active engagement of change ambassadors who can act as catalysts, and the alignment of the school's vision, values, and objectives across all levels. These three elements—Commit, Engage, Align—collectively ensure that any developmental strategies are not only adopted but also integrated into the school's culture, leading to meaningful and lasting improvements.

Navigating Organisational Culture in International Schools: A Toolkit for Change
Organisational culture is the DNA that shapes the identity and success of international schools. With unique challenges like high staff turnover and diverse educational philosophies, understanding and shaping this culture becomes even more critical. This blog post introduces key toolkits like OCTAPACE and the '5 Dysfunctions of a Team,' offering school leaders actionable insights to audit and transform their organisational culture.
